Trenchless Construction
CMD Civil can install Gas, Fibre optic, Water, Sewer, Electrical and Telecommunication services using trenchless technology.
The main advantages of using trenchless techniques compared with open cut are:
- Overall project costs are lower
- Able to minimise any traffic disruption
- Exposure to construction hazards are reduced for both the community and site personnel
- Reduces risk of damaging existing utilities
- Less impact to the surrounding community and environment
